Ada Ramp Installation in Wilmington, NC
ADA ramp installation services provide accessible solutions for homeowners seeking to improve entryways and ensure compliance with accessibility standards. These ramps are designed to accommodate wheelchairs, walkers, and other mobility devices, making it easier for individuals with disabilities or limited mobility to access entrances such as front doors, garages, or patios. Projects can range from installing new ramps on existing steps to constructing custom-designed ramps for new or renovated properties, including both residential and commercial spaces.
Property owners typically want to understand the different types of ramps available, such as portable, modular, or custom-built options, and how each can suit their specific property layout. It’s important to consider factors like the slope, surface material, and space requirements before requesting installation services. Additionally, understanding local building codes and accessibility guidelines can help ensure the project meets necessary standards for safety and usability.

Ada Ramp Installation Questions
What is an ADA ramp? An ADA ramp is a wheelchair-accessible incline designed to provide safe and easy access for individuals with mobility challenges.
Where are ADA ramps typically installed? ADA ramps are commonly installed at building entrances, porches, and pathways to ensure compliance and accessibility.
What materials are used for ADA ramp installation? Common materials include aluminum, wood, and concrete, chosen for durability and safety.
Are there design considerations for ADA ramps? Yes, ramps should have a gentle slope, proper width, and handrails to meet accessibility standards.
